On Friday, December 27, the National Centre RUSSIA hosted a children's press conference with the All-Russian Ded Moroz. For the young participants of the event, a tour of the National Centre was organized. The children learned how the dreams of science fiction writers became reality, got acquainted with the latest developments of domestic scientists, and visited the exposition "Legacy for the Future."

The tour for the young guests began in the Library of the Future, where they discovered the ideas proposed by science fiction writers of the past. Then the children proceeded to the Hall of Inventions, where they saw many modern inventions in person. Finally, the children walked through the Gallery, explored the exposition "Legacy for the Future," and admired the vibrant and unusual works of young artists from different countries.

The children were accompanied by students of the Young Guide School, which operates at the National Centre RUSSIA under the guidance of an experienced guide, Evgeny Artemenkov. The young guides enthusiastically spoke about all the works in the centre and shared fascinating facts about our country.

"It was so interesting! The National Centre is so big and beautiful, and there are so many different exhibits. I was especially excited to see the high-speed train that even Ded Moroz himself traveled on. I recommend this tour to everyone. It's very educational," shared Darja Sokolova, a participant of the press conference.

Let us remind you that the National Centre RUSSIA offers several different tours: "Inventing the Future," dedicated to key expositions; "Make a Wish," focused on folk crafts from various regions of the country; and the children's tour "Future Begins Today," where young guests can explore the exhibits of the National Centre in a playful format.

The National Centre RUSSIA was established by order of the President of the Russian Federation, Vladimir Putin, to preserve the legacy of the International RUSSIA EXPO and to showcase the achievements of the country and its citizens on a permanent basis. Federal government agencies, state companies, corporations, and regions take part in the Centre’s work. 

The National Centre RUSSIA is located at 14 Krasnopresnenskaya Embankment, Moscow. The Centre is open from 10:00 to 20:00 every day except Monday.
